A grader operator in the construction industry is responsible for operating heavy machinery called graders, which are used to level and shape the ground surface on construction sites. They work closely with the site supervisor and follow blueprints and instructions to ensure accurate grading of the land. Grader operators inspect the equipment before use, perform routine maintenance, and report any malfunctions. They are skilled in controlling the grader's speed, blade angle, and height to achieve the desired level of precision. Safety is a top priority, as they must be aware of their surroundings and communicate effectively with other workers on the site. The job requires physical stamina, hand-eye coordination, and the ability to work in various weather conditions.

Grader Operator Construction salary in China
Average Yearly Salary of Grader Operator Construction in China is approximately 87,860 CNY (11,027 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.
